Brewhahas Burger Emporium in Sebring
Last inspected:
301 Circle Park Dr, Sebring, FL 33870Brewhahas Burger Emporium in Sebring has accumulated 61 violations across 10 inspections since 2024, averaging 6.1 violations per inspection, significantly above the Florida statewide average of 5.2. High-priority violations have been cited in at least 8 of the 10 inspections, with handwashing and proper cooking temperature violations appearing repeatedly across the record. Specific recurring high-priority findings include improper hand and arm washing (cited in at least 5 inspections), shell stock handling requirement violations (4 inspections), and proper cooking temperature violations (4 inspections). The facility also received citations for employee health reporting failures, parasite destruction, approved food source violations, and time as a control violations. An administrative complaint was recommended following inspections on July 18, 2025 and March 8, 2024. The most recent inspection on February 20, 2026 documented 18 violations including high-priority handwashing and shell stock violations, and was completed with no further action required.
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
